Introduction
If you hold a valid concession card, you can apply online to redirect your mail, for a reduced rate.
Holders of the following concession cards will need to apply in person at a Post Office:
- Department of Veterans' Affairs Card
- MyPost Concession Card
- Norfolk Island Social Services Card
- Veterans' Repatriation Health Card.
You'll also need to apply at a Post Office if you:
- want to redirect mail overseas
- are applying on behalf of a deceased estate.
Eligibility
You're able to apply online if you hold (or you’re listed as a dependant on) a:
- Commonwealth Seniors Health Card
- Health Care Card (all types)
- Pensioner Concession Card.
What you need
- new and old address details
- your contact details
- name of each person redirecting mail
- your proof of identity documents
- your concession card
- payment (visit the Australia Post website for fees).
How to apply
- Select the ‘Apply online’ button.
- Complete the online form.
- Enter your proof of identify details.
- Enter payment details.
- Submit the form.
If you’re unable to apply online:
- Download and complete the Application to redirect mail form – PDF.
- Gather your supporting documentation.
- Visit a Post Office and submit your application with payment.
More information
- Allow 3 full working days to process your application before your mail redirection can start.
- You may be eligible for a free 12-month mail redirection if you're in charge of a deceased estate or a victim of domestic violence or natural disaster.
